Understanding What "Restoration Help" Actually Means

The word "restoration" covers a broad spectrum of work. A homeowner dealing with a burst pipe has different needs than a building manager overseeing post-fire structural stabilization or a property owner navigating mold remediation after a slow leak. The category of help required depends on the nature and scope of the damage, not simply on the emergency itself.

At the most immediate level, help means stopping additional loss — containing water intrusion, boarding up fire-damaged openings, or isolating a contaminated area. Beyond that, restoration help encompasses assessment, documentation, drying and dehumidification, cleaning, reconstruction, and in many cases, coordination with insurance adjusters and third-party environmental consultants.

The distinction between restoration, remediation, and mitigation is not semantic. Each term carries specific regulatory and contractual meaning that affects what a contractor is authorized to do, what an insurance policy is obligated to cover, and what sequence of work is legally required. When to Seek Professional Help — and How Urgently

Not every property damage situation requires immediate emergency response, but several categories demand professional involvement within hours, not days.

Water damage requires rapid response because secondary damage — microbial growth, structural swelling, compromised electrical systems — begins within 24 to 72 hours of initial exposure. The IICRC S500 Standard for Professional Water Damage Restoration establishes industry protocols for moisture assessment and drying timelines. Attempting to self-dry without proper equipment and psychrometric monitoring routinely leads to hidden moisture pockets that result in mold colonization weeks later. Mold remediation involving more than 10 square feet of visible growth is subject to specific handling and containment guidance under EPA's Mold Remediation in Schools and Commercial Buildings publication (EPA 402-K-01-001) and, in several states, additional licensing requirements. At the residential scale, New York State Local Law 55 and Texas Administrative Code Title 25, Chapter 295 represent examples of jurisdictionally specific mold remediation statutes that govern contractor qualifications.

Fire and smoke damage raises immediate concerns about structural integrity, toxic residues from synthetic materials, and coordinated documentation for insurance purposes. Soot and smoke residues contain carcinogenic compounds and require professional-grade personal protective equipment and cleaning protocols.

Asbestos and lead are common in pre-1980 construction and are frequently disturbed during restoration work. Federal regulations under EPA's NESHAP (40 CFR Part 61, Subpart M) and OSHA's 29 CFR 1926.1101 govern asbestos-containing material handling in renovation and demolition contexts. Homeowners and contractors alike are legally required to address these hazards before proceeding with restoration in qualifying structures. Common Barriers to Getting Effective Help

Several recurring obstacles prevent property owners from accessing competent restoration assistance efficiently.

Insurance confusion is the most frequent. Many policyholders do not understand the difference between a preferred vendor assigned by their insurer and an independently retained contractor. This distinction has meaningful financial and quality implications. The insurer's preferred vendor operates under a negotiated rate agreement with the carrier — an arrangement that may or may not align with the property owner's interests. Credential skepticism cuts both ways. Some contractors inflate their qualifications; some property owners dismiss certifications they don't recognize. The restoration industry has legitimate credentialing bodies — primarily the Institute of Inspection, Cleaning and Restoration Certification (IICRC), the Restoration Industry Association (RIA), and the Indoor Air Quality Association (IAQA) — whose certifications represent documented training against published technical standards. Scope disagreements between property owners and contractors, or between contractors and insurance adjusters, are extremely common. These disputes often hinge on technical documentation: moisture readings, drying logs, air quality data, and photographic records. Property owners who are unprepared for these disputes — or who sign authorization documents without understanding them — frequently lose leverage mid-project.

Timeline misunderstanding leads to unrealistic expectations and premature decisions. A full structural drying cycle following category 2 or 3 water damage may take 3 to 5 days under ideal conditions; mold remediation may take considerably longer depending on scope. What Questions to Ask Before Hiring a Restoration Contractor

The quality of a restoration outcome is heavily influenced by decisions made in the first 24 to 48 hours — particularly in contractor selection. Before authorizing any work, several questions warrant direct answers.

Is the contractor certified under IICRC standards relevant to the damage type (WRT for water, FSRT for fire, AMRT for applied microbial remediation)? Is the firm licensed in the state where the work will occur, and does that license cover both mitigation and reconstruction if both are needed? Who specifically will perform the work — the estimator's team or a subcontractor? What documentation will be provided throughout the project, and in what format?

Evaluating Sources of Restoration Information

The volume of restoration-related content online is substantial, and the accuracy varies widely. Marketing content from service providers, franchise promotional material, and generalized home improvement websites frequently present simplified or commercially motivated guidance as authoritative fact.

Reliable primary sources include the IICRC's published standards (S500, S520, S700, S800), EPA guidelines for specific contaminant types, OSHA standards applicable to restoration work environments, and state-level regulatory agency publications. For insurance-related questions, the National Association of Public Insurance Adjusters (NAPIA) and state department of insurance publications provide consumer-accessible guidance.
